The Evolution of TayMac®

In 1989, TayMac was founded by Michael Shotey. Michael was a pool builder by trade and his work eventually led him to invent In-Use cover technology. Mr. Shotey's idea, funded by investor McLellan, allowed for the formation of TayMac. 

In 1997, TayMac sold the first In-Use cover to The Home Depot. In 2008, the organization launched a line of metallic weatherproof products. Shortly thereafter in 2011, TayMac introduced Extra Duty, metallic In-Use covers. 

In 2012, TayMac was acquired by Hubbell Inc. Further expanding its offerings, the organization launched Extra Duty, nonmetallic In-Use covers. TayMac continues to flourish by setting the standard with industry leading innovation in In-Use cover technologies.
